-
Notifications
You must be signed in to change notification settings - Fork 1.3k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
[databricks] Add intuitive command line options for Azure Databricks Enhanced Security Compliance feature #8353
base: main
Are you sure you want to change the base?
Conversation
|
rule | cmd_name | rule_message | suggest_message |
---|---|---|---|
databricks workspace create | cmd databricks workspace create added parameter compliance_standards |
||
databricks workspace create | cmd databricks workspace create added parameter enable_automatic_cluster_update |
||
databricks workspace create | cmd databricks workspace create added parameter enable_compliance_security_profile |
||
databricks workspace create | cmd databricks workspace create added parameter enable_enhanced_security_monitoring |
||
databricks workspace update | cmd databricks workspace update added parameter compliance_standards |
||
databricks workspace update | cmd databricks workspace update added parameter enable_automatic_cluster_update |
||
databricks workspace update | cmd databricks workspace update added parameter enable_compliance_security_profile |
||
databricks workspace update | cmd databricks workspace update added parameter enable_enhanced_security_monitoring |
Hi @windoze, |
Thank you for your contribution! We will review the pull request and get back to you soon. |
🚫All pull requests will be blocked to merge until Jan 6, 2025 due to CCOA |
CodeGen Tools Feedback CollectionThank you for using our CodeGen tool. We value your feedback, and we would like to know how we can improve our product. Please take a few minutes to fill our codegen survey |
|
/azp run |
Azure Pipelines successfully started running 2 pipeline(s). |
Add following options to
az databricks workspace create
andaz databricks workspace update
commandsThese options cover the function of the existing
--enhanced-security-compliance
option, but accept simple values instead of a JSON or YAML file as the input.The customer complained about the existing option being not intuitive and hard to use in the script, this PR is to resolve the issue.
This checklist is used to make sure that common guidelines for a pull request are followed.
Related command
The options were added to the following commands:
az databricks workspace create
az databricks workspace update
General Guidelines
azdev style <YOUR_EXT>
locally? (pip install azdev
required)python scripts/ci/test_index.py -q
locally? (pip install wheel==0.30.0
required)For new extensions:
About Extension Publish
There is a pipeline to automatically build, upload and publish extension wheels.
Once your pull request is merged into main branch, a new pull request will be created to update
src/index.json
automatically.You only need to update the version information in file setup.py and historical information in file HISTORY.rst in your PR but do not modify
src/index.json
.